Output 295562312b2d31a29dfbe2d07c72a4f2916fcfed69386183d348eb902810f11a:4

value
19380500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34aa1a1142b337697a6f21d389424d6e21ed4327 OP_EQUAL
address
MChd9HdAooH1WWALmjCwMed5ue16VG4Bag
transaction
295562312b2d31a29dfbe2d07c72a4f2916fcfed69386183d348eb902810f11a
spent
true